Abstract
In a process for preparing a polyolefin without separation of catalyst residues by polymerizing an olefin in the pres ence of a Ziegler catalyst having high catalytic activity, in an inert gas sealing system; an improvement comprises separating the polyolefin containing the catalyst residue from the polymerization mixture, and contacting the polyolefin containing the catalyst residue with a weak reactive gas of oxygen and/or steam diluted with an inert gas.
